Output 764549950b3bf078c3c92950fafc801d71f1bc7242947e54564025edf0a35753:7

value
2175887600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b2526391d774bf82c90f8f038baeb7fe3bd6ec8 OP_EQUAL
address
34AYfuHys2X4Nu8U7RqpRiiZdUbmCA7WhB
transaction
764549950b3bf078c3c92950fafc801d71f1bc7242947e54564025edf0a35753
spent
true